100minds is a fantastic initiative that I am delighted to be part of. 100 of Ireland's top undergraduate students are coming together to raise €1000 each and collectively raise a fantastic €100,000 for Temple Street Children's Hospital. This is an excellent charity to have partnered with and EVERY cent you donate will go towards helping the children and enhancing quality of life for them and their families.
